while it is true that transmission of HIV by means of unprotected oral sex is less likely than it is through unprotected anal sex, the possibility of transmission cannot be ruled out. The HIV virus is present in both semen and precum; the fact that he didnt come in your mouth is good, but precum may still have been present in your mouth.

if you are still concerned for your health, I suggest you go for a sexual health check up now, to check that you dont already have any problems, and then again in about 3 months time to ensure that you did not receive anything from the man.
